Comments : The original card was lost in mail by USPS. We e-filed a replacement card on April 8 and requested an expedition based on financial loss (with my offer letter faxed as a supporting document requested by USCIS via email) on April 10. Meanwhile, we sought help from Congressman Roger Williams to expedite the case. On April 15, the case status showed "Card production" and the Congressman office phoned to inform us the progress. Btw, USCIS just skipped my biometrics even though I got the notice for the biometrics appointment scheduled on April 30.

**EAD card was finally received on April 21 and I was scheduled to return to work on April 22. The valid date is from 2014-02-11 to 2015-02-10.

P.S. We tried everything we could do to express our dissatisfaction with USCIS and USPS. We contacted our local post office (supervisor and mailmen), Consumer Affairs Office, Ombudsman's Office, Info Pass at San Antonio TX and filed a police report as a precaution of identity theft. All feedback we'd received was disappointing and frustrating so I would suggest to e-file a replacement card as soon as you believe the card is lost in mail no matter how long (normally it's 30 days) the customer service told you to wait. As soon as USCIS received the money, a new case starts all over again and it's finally to see the hope and some progress going on.

Comments : Application packet returned on 05/12 due to incorrect fee of money order (correct fee $590 without dependents). Application packet resubmitted on 05/14 and NOA letter received less than two weeks.

07/05 called USCIS and got a request service for not receiving the biometrics appointment letter for over 45 days of the first NOA date. 7/18 received USCIS reply in email and finally got the ASC letter on 08/05 to schedule my biometrics appointment on 8/18.

01/18 "new card is being produced".
01/23 "card was mailed to me"
01/27 New card received in mail
